Introduction To CMS
Content Management system (CMS) is a great tool to create a professional and business website with no coding to learn. We may define CMS as a web application used to develop websites, manage websites and its content in a very easy way. To get started with CMS you just need install the CMS on your webserver. Once any CMS is installed successfully, you get a ready made website with default look and layout. Thus you save lots of time to get started. Another best thing about CMS is that you dont need to laern any coding and most of the top CMS is free to use.
There are many popular CMS like:
1) Drupal
2) Joomla
3) Mambo
4) PhpNuke
5) PostNuke
6) Xoops
7) PHP-Fusion
